What Hypercubic does

Hypercubic is an AI-native infrastructure for mainframe operations and modernization. We help enterprises understand and modernize their mission-critical legacy systems. About 70% of the Fortune 500 companies still rely on them to run their core business applications in banking, insurance, telecom, airlines, retail, and more. These systems, originally built in the 1960s - 90s, still power trillions in global infrastructure today but have become increasingly opaque as original developers retire or leave the workforce. What is your company going to make? Please describe your product and what it does or will do.

We're building an AI-native tool that helps enterprises understand and modernize their COBOL-based mainframe systems. Our product reads through decades-old legacy code to map and reason about how core business logic works. It makes the infrastructure less opaque as original developers retire, enabling companies in banking, insurance, telecom, and other sectors to safely update and maintain these mission-critical systems.
